All-Inclusive Holidays in Larnaca - History and nature combine
Larnaca is situated a short 15 minute drive from the airport, making it ideal for that family holiday in Cyprus. In the centre of the town, which is built right next to the beaches, you will find everyday conveniences such as shops, banks and tourist information offices. The strip is a favourite holiday destination for families, as young groups make their way to the more famous party town of Paphos. In Larnaca you will find plenty of high quality restaurants, which are perfect after a day on one of the many beaches that line the shore. Of particular note are the beaches of McKenzie and Yanathes, where you will find the beach fairly free from crowds in all except the highest of the summer season. All-inclusive family holidays in Cyprus wouldn’t be the same without a trip to some of the ruins that can be visited in Larnaca; head to the Church of Lazarus to marvel at one of one of the oldest churches in the region.
